Description

We propose to identify the algorithms, architectures and performance evaluation criteria for real-time, high-resolution, long-range imaging through atmospheric turbulence. The most promising algorithms will be implemented on a hardware acceleration platform. The end-goal for phase 1 is to develop a complete system design ready to be implemented in hardware for real-time video processing of 2Kx2K video imagery with frame rates of 400HZ. The key to achieving this end-goal is an integrated and experienced team consisting of hardware platforms experts, imaging specialists and system-level designers. Working together, this team can simultaneously develop and integrate the image processing algorithms for turbulence mitigation, build the necessary hardware platforms, and optimize the system further for better serving military needs. For phase 1 option we propose to investigate the use of high-speed, multi-channel deformable mirrors hardware and stochastic optimization algorithms to improve imaging performance beyond what is possible without optical wavefront aberration correction.
